About the style
Industrial interior design takes inspiration from warehouses, workshops and converted loft spaces. It uses visible structure, raw materials and practical furniture to create a bold architectural character. Warm wood, textiles and layered lighting help balance harder surfaces such as concrete, brick and metal.
Concrete, brick, visible structure and unfinished-looking surfaces form the visual foundation.
Dark colors, strong contrasts and substantial furniture create a confident appearance.
Pipes, beams, frames and structural details become part of the interior composition.
Furniture and lighting often use practical forms inspired by workshops and commercial spaces.

Materials
Concrete surfaces provide the neutral architectural base typical of industrial interiors.
Metal frames, lighting and shelving create clear structure and contrast.
Exposed brick introduces color, texture and visual history.
Wood softens metal and concrete while preserving the robust character of the style.
Practical recommendations
Use dark metal accents to connect lighting, shelving and furniture.
Balance concrete or brick surfaces with warm wood and comfortable textiles.
Choose substantial furniture with simple and practical forms.
Use visible bulbs or architectural lighting selectively rather than everywhere.
Preserve open layouts where possible to support the loft-inspired character.
Add rugs, curtains and upholstered seating to improve comfort and acoustics.
Avoid these mistakes
Without lighter elements, an industrial room can feel smaller and unnecessarily heavy.
Concrete, brick and metal need textiles and warm wood to create a comfortable living environment.
Decorative pipes and random workshop objects can look artificial when they have no relationship to the space.
Dark palettes require several light sources to preserve depth and usability.
